Year after year some hospital supply chain staff use the same process to complete their inventory counts. Additionally, systems and networks often allow their hospitals to complete their counts by whatever process they're comfortable with. These processes often end up causing employees to work countless hours and be paid overtime, causing many hospitals to lose thousands of dollars of revenue.

A recent article in Becker's Hospital Review outlined the ongoing issues hospitals face with their supply chains. It is no secret that most hospitals struggle to reduce costs in their supply chains and often use an inaccurate and outdated process to complete their inventory counts.
